#include <dlfcn.h>
#include <link.h>
#include <stdio.h>
#include <stdlib.h>
#include <string.h>
#include <gnu/lib-names.h>
static int
do_test (void)
{
void *handle = dlopen ("modstatic2-nonexistent.so", RTLD_LAZY);
if (handle == NULL)
printf ("nonexistent: %s\n", dlerror ());
else
exit (1);
handle = dlopen ("modstatic2.so", RTLD_LAZY);
if (handle == NULL)
{
printf ("%s\n", dlerror ());
exit (1);
}
int (*test) (FILE *, int);
test = dlsym (handle, "test");
if (test == NULL)
{
printf ("%s\n", dlerror ());
exit (1);
}
Dl_info info;
int res = dladdr (test, &info);
if (res == 0)
{
puts ("dladdr returned 0");
exit (1);
}
else
{
if (strstr (info.dli_fname, "modstatic2.so") == NULL
|| strcmp (info.dli_sname, "test") != 0)
{
printf ("fname %s sname %s\n", info.dli_fname, info.dli_sname);
exit (1);
}
if (info.dli_saddr != (void *) test)
{
printf ("saddr %p != test %p\n", info.dli_saddr, test);
exit (1);
}
}
ElfW(Sym) *sym;
void *symp;
res = dladdr1 (test, &info, &symp, RTLD_DL_SYMENT);
if (res == 0)
{
puts ("dladdr1 returned 0");
exit (1);
}
else
{
if (strstr (info.dli_fname, "modstatic2.so") == NULL
|| strcmp (info.dli_sname, "test") != 0)
{
printf ("fname %s sname %s\n", info.dli_fname, info.dli_sname);
exit (1);
}
if (info.dli_saddr != (void *) test)
{
printf ("saddr %p != test %p\n", info.dli_saddr, test);
exit (1);
}
sym = symp;
if (sym == NULL)
{
puts ("sym == NULL\n");
exit (1);
}
if (ELF32_ST_BIND (sym->st_info) != STB_GLOBAL
|| ELF32_ST_VISIBILITY (sym->st_other) != STV_DEFAULT)
{
printf ("bind %d visibility %d\n",
(int) ELF32_ST_BIND (sym->st_info),
(int) ELF32_ST_VISIBILITY (sym->st_other));
exit (1);
}
}
Lmid_t lmid;
res = dlinfo (handle, RTLD_DI_LMID, &lmid);
if (res != 0)
{
printf ("dlinfo returned %d %s\n", res, dlerror ());
exit (1);
}
else if (lmid != LM_ID_BASE)
{
printf ("lmid %d != %d\n", (int) lmid, (int) LM_ID_BASE);
exit (1);
}
res = test (stdout, 2);
if (res != 4)
{
printf ("Got %i, expected 4\n", res);
exit (1);
}
void *handle2 = dlopen (LIBDL_SO, RTLD_LAZY);
if (handle2 == NULL)
{
printf ("libdl.so: %s\n", dlerror ());
exit (1);
}
if (dlvsym (handle2, "_dlfcn_hook", "GLIBC_PRIVATE") == NULL)
{
printf ("dlvsym: %s\n", dlerror ());
exit (1);
}
void *(*dlsymfn) (void *, const char *);
dlsymfn = dlsym (handle2, "dlsym");
if (dlsymfn == NULL)
{
printf ("dlsym \"dlsym\": %s\n", dlerror ());
exit (1);
}
void *test2 = dlsymfn (handle, "test");
if (test2 == NULL)
{
printf ("%s\n", dlerror ());
exit (1);
}
else if (test2 != (void *) test)
{
printf ("test %p != test2 %p\n", test, test2);
exit (1);
}
dlclose (handle2);
dlclose (handle);
handle = dlmopen (LM_ID_BASE, "modstatic2.so", RTLD_LAZY);
if (handle == NULL)
{
printf ("%s\n", dlerror ());
exit (1);
}
dlclose (handle);
handle = dlmopen (LM_ID_NEWLM, "modstatic2.so", RTLD_LAZY);
if (handle == NULL)
printf ("LM_ID_NEWLM: %s\n", dlerror ());
else
{
puts ("LM_ID_NEWLM unexpectedly succeeded");
exit (1);
}
return 0;
}
#define TEST_FUNCTION do_test ()
#include "../test-skeleton.c"
